THE FEMINIST STREETCAR

Abstract: Almost anyone who is familiar with "A Streetcar Named Desire" has one or two scenes they know, even if they haven't seen the play; namely, the rape scene and the poker scene. This paper examines these and other scenes from the play from a "feminist" perspective, while also focusing on the female characters and the use of sexual politics between Stanley and Blanche. Bibliography lists 5 sources.
